Tea and Tarot: The Art of Intuitive Blending
Tea and Tarot: The Art of Intuitive Blending
Unearth insights and intentionally blend herbs and teas at our Community Tea & Tarot gathering—an elevated tarot experience that goes far beyond a traditional card pull. Draw from a curated selection of herb-themed oracle and tarot card decks to connect to your query, revealing the essence of a plant ally that will become the base herb for a tea you create. Each card corresponds to one of the 36+ herb jars included on our crafting table, forming an altar to plant allies and spirit guides, creating a container in which we navigate the liminal space between the abstract and the tangible, the spiritual and the embodied, and where we prepare to infuse with intuition. Guided by Teishu Mike Barberesi, certified tea sommelier and Taoist tea witch, the gathering unfolds as ritual: grounding meditation, shared reflection, storytelling, communal insight, and collective meaning-making, culminating in the creation of your own custom tea blend ceremoniously sealed with wax, a dried flower, and your intention so that you can integrate the tea ritual into your practice. Arkham Horror (6pm)
Arkham Horror (6pm)
Arkham Horror Third Edition is a cooperative board game for one to six players who take on the roles of investigators trying to rid the world of eldritch beings known as Ancient Ones. Based on the works of H.P. Lovecraft, players will have to gather clues, defeat terrifying monsters, and find tools and allies if they are to stand any chance of defeating the creatures that dwell just beyond the veil of our reality.
